    All Aboard The Polar Express
    on December 6th at Spook Hall in Jerome.

    November 11, 2013No Comments
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Email Reddit WhatsApp
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Reddit WhatsApp

    20131111_Polar-Express-Promo_RonChilston_MG_3261Jerome AZ (November 11, 2013) – The Polar Express has become a favorite Christmas tradition for more than 5 million readers. Join the Jerome Chamber of Commerce as they host a cozy holiday party where kids can participate in lots of fun activities, including writing a letter to Santa, making an ornament, hot chocolate, a great cookie and a reading of the classic children’s story. Anyone with the book can bring it and read along. Pajamas are welcome and encouraged. Tickets should be purchased in advance at Mooey Christmas on Jerome Avenue in Jerome or credit card sales by phone at 634-2604. Only 160 tickets will be sold. The event will be held at Spook Hall in Jerome on December 6th – 260 Hull Avenue and begins at 6:00PM. Tickets are $5 per person. Adults must accompany the children.
